Why a House Mold Set? (Besides the obvious answer: they are awesome!)
Lightbulb moment occurred a couple weeks ago. Friends, who never show interest in chips, suddenly lit up at the idea of playing with house mold chips from casinos they recognize, especially if some chips are live. I asked about a set that is all from one casino...much less interest. Mixed set is where it's at and if a mixed house mold gets my friends excited to play, then maybe this is where I should invest.

Re-label?
Over label only. And I'd prefer to minimize the amount of that.

What Chips Do I Already Have?
I own 2 racks of Lucky 21 hot-stamped 5s. I love these and intend to use them as nickels - a barrel a head. Cuz, yes, those are the stakes I play! None of the other chips in quantity yet.

Proposal #1
This is my dream (but unrealistic) lineup. I already have the Lucky 21 chips. I can get the Luxor, Mandalay Bay, and Caesar's. Getting a rack or more of the Cache Creek is probably going to be impossible (or if possible, at a high price).

Proposal #2
I am strongly leaning this way. Much more attainable. Cache Creek as or Dunes as $100. I don't think the Sundance $5 works quite as well, but it is still fine and I can get racks. Yes, it is red and the Lucky 21 is pink, but in real life they are distinguishable, even in dim (that pink really fluoresces!). And playing 5c/10c, I don't expect more than a couple $5s on the table as value chips. Also, less over-labeling, particularly if I go with the Dunes $100.

Proposal #3
The Resort World $2 as a nickel looks great and fits progression. The peach color matches the Mandalay Bay perfectly. But 2 strikes against this lineup. Harvesting $2 chips for both the nickel and quarter will get pricey. Also, the grey GN (as much as I love it) blends a bit too much with the $1 in dim light - and they will get a lot of play together.
